HC Deb 18 December 1945 vol 417 c1285W
Mr. S. Shephard

asked the Minister of Labour why he has issued instructions to his regional officers that applications for Class B release are not to be accepted if the Serviceman in question is due for Class A release within three months.

Mr. Isaacs

No such instructions have been issued to my regional officers, who are in no way concerned with accepting applications for Class B release. In practice, however, sponsoring Departments do not ordinarily recommend the release in Class B of men who would in any event be released within two or three months in Class A, as it would not normally be worth while.
